Economy & Jobs

The median household income in Marblemount is $99,006, which is significantly higher than the national average — 32% above $75,149. This places Marblemount among higher-income communities. The job market is very strong with unemployment at just 0.0%. Only 0.0% of residents live below the poverty line, well below the national rate of 12.4%. Workers commute an average of 26 minutes.

Cost of Living & Housing

The median home value in Marblemount is $295,300, roughly aligned with the national median of $281,900. At just 3x median income, home prices are very affordable relative to local earnings.

Education

9.1% of residents hold a bachelor's degree, below the national average of 33.7%. 88.9% have completed high school. Area schools have an average test score of 5.4/10.

Climate & Weather

Marblemount experiences four distinct seasons with an average temperature of 50°F. Winters average 37°F in January while summers reach 64°F in July. Annual precipitation totals 83.0 inches.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 28.

Marblemount has a population of 318 with a density of 86 people per square mile. The median age is 54.5 years, 40% older than the national median of 38.9. The city is predominantly White (100%).
